The Evolution of Payline Structures: From Simplicity to Complexity

Traditionally, slot machines introduced in land-based casinos featured a limited number of paylines, often just a single line. As technology advanced, game designers experimented with multiple paylines to diversify winning combinations, enhance player engagement, and introduce strategic variables.

Today, the industry commonly offers a variety of configurations, ranging from basic 3-reel setups to elaborate multi-line games boasting 243, 1024, or even more potential paylines. However, amidst this spectrum, slots with 10 paylines stand out as a balanced compromise—offering enough variability to keep gameplay interesting without overwhelming players with excessive complexity.

The Role of Paylines in Player Strategy and RTP

From a strategic standpoint, the number of paylines influences the game’s Return to Player (RTP) and variance. Slots with 10 paylines often maintain a favorable RTP—commonly around 95%—while balancing variance to appeal to both risk-averse and thrill-seeking players.
